We'll Not Be Sympathetic If You Refuse To Record Fuel Money - Apaak Tells Chieftaincy Ministry

The Director for Ministry of Chieftaincy and Religious Affairs, Benjamin Afful has indicated that his outfit has put in place apt measures to ensure that all trips by officials are documented in the log book.

According to him, the Ministry has appointed an Assistant Director in charge of Transport and Estate to ensure that all log in are verified after documentation.

Mr. Afful’s response comes after Member of Parliament for Builsa South constituency, Dr. Clement Apaak questioned the Minister on measures his ministry has put in place to ensure that expenditure on official trips are recorded by the office.

Responding to Dr. Clement Apaak, the Minister explained that new proficient measures have been put in place to ensure all official trips are monitored.

“All the vehicles have log books and we have an Assistant Director who is responsible for Transport and Estate who verifies the entries,” he said.

The Member of Parliament added that the committee will not be sympathetic if the Ministry falls to record fuel money of the Ministry.

The Ministry of Chieftaincy and Religious Affairs appeared before the Public Account Committee of parliament for questioning on report of the Auditor-General on the Public Accounts of Ghana ministries, Department and other agencies for the year 2016.
